LAW ENFORCEMENT NEWS....Shooting This Evening in Avery Sheep Ranch Area

Posted by: Kim_Hamilton on 08/23/2008 09:36 PM
Avery, CA....There was a shooting at approximately 6pm this evening in the Avery Sheep Ranch area. One man was shot with a small caliber handgun and was medi-flighted to a hospital in the valley, but is expected to recover. Law enforcement personnel have been conducting a search for the assailant. Apparently the two individuals knew one another. We are awaiting a return call from the Sheriff's office for additional information. We also have unconfirmed reports, that the assailant left the scene of the incident on a quad and was heading out towards the Sheep Ranch area. More to come as we have more concrete details. UPDATE #1 As of 10:58pm this evening, according to CHP officials, they are still searching for the assailant....

1/3 of the Homes in Calaveras County May Lack Final Inspections States Community Development Department

Posted by: thepinetree on 06/17/2008 12:16 PM
San Andreas, CA...Final Inspections in addition to the Budget, Flood Plain and other issues were in front of the Calaveras County Board of Supervisors today. At nearly the close of the meeting Supervisor Tryon wanted to see the Board hold a study session at a future date on the CDA's current reexamination of property records to see whether homes and other building projects have in fact had final inspections. Stephanie Moreno came in to address the Board on this topic. She mentioned that her department is charging nominal, typically under $200 fees for the final inspections and that the inspections are held to the standards of the codes which were in effect when the projects were built. A larger bombshell that came out during this discussion, may possibly be the number of homes and projects her department feels may be in need of final inspections. The CDA staff estimates that up to "1/3 of the homes in Calaveas County may need final inspection"...
